Description

Speckle jacquard weave cross ripple glaze fabric
Technical field
The present invention relates to a kind of fabric, particularly relate to a kind of fabric making high-grade cold protective clothing, belong to field of textile.
Background technology
Along with the development of national economy, people are more and more higher, except warming, comfortable, environmental protection to the requirement of life dressing Outward, attractive in appearance, proper is also critically important index.Woollen cloth is a kind of woolen knitwear, and it is well-pressed, abundant, therefore extremely walks in autumn and winter market Pretty, but its fabric is typically all average, does not has third dimension, and feel is the poorest, cold-proof weak effect, can not meet people multi-faceted Demand.
Summary of the invention
It is an object of the invention to overcome above-mentioned deficiency, it is provided that a kind of be rich in third dimension, feel strong, cold-proof effective ten Word ripple glaze fabric.
The object of the present invention is achieved like this: a kind of speckle jacquard weave cross ripple glaze fabric, including fabric body, described The outer surface of fabric body is provided with some projections, and described projection is wavy, and described projection and fabric body are connected as an entirety, Described projection and fabric body are that an angle of 90 degrees tilts, and arranged in parallel.Described fabric body is made into by warp and parallel, and warp is adopted With tossa, parallel uses polyvinyl chloride fibre, wherein a diameter of 21.76 μm of tossa, and fiber number is 253dtex, poly- A diameter of 45.71 μm of vinyl chloride fibers, fiber number is 573dtex, is 23.8/cm through density, and weft density is 54.8/cm. Described fabric body inner surface is provided with backing fabric layers, described backing fabric layers, for a kind of speckle jacquard fabric, for positive and negative double Face jacquard fabric, its front has uniformly been independently distributed salient point, and this salient point uses the first yarn jacquard weave to be formed on base fabric, its reverse side For being formed at the vertical striped of base fabric reverse side by the second yarn jacquard weave, parallel between adjacent stripes.
Present configuration is reasonable, and third dimension, feel are strong, cold-proof effective, can meet the consumer of special requirement.
Compared with prior art, the invention has the beneficial effects as follows:
The concaveconvex structure that the protruding wave stripe of cross ripple glaze fabric is formed, enhance cross ripple glaze fabric third dimension and Feel, fabric is cold-proof effective.
The no graphic structure of tow sides jacquard weave of the present invention, demand that can be the most different, protruding that speckle can with base fabric Dye two kinds of colors that color bumps against, third dimension is strong, has beautiful outward appearance, and the vertical striped of base fabric reverse side can reinforced fabric Standing sense.
